I know this thread hasn't been active for over a year, but I need help, I just cannot get the game to boot on my homebrewed Wii. I have the game patched and it appears to load correctly (The game's animated channel screen shows up on USB Loader GX) and I moved the save file to my Wii's system memory but when I press play I get just a black screen. Same thing happens on Dolphin with the save loaded on there too. If anyone knows how to fix this please let me know!

Hello. Are you using a PAL Wii, and if so, did you set the video mode to NTSC (Japanese and US system)? Otherwise you'll get a black screen with any foreign game. Please let me know. :)

Hello! I want to thank you so much for getting back to me so soon, it is very kind of you to help me out :)

I'm using an NTSC-U Wii with region free enabled in Priiloader. In other words, my Wii has no problem running other foreign titles like the Fatal Frame games (one is NTSC-J and the other is PAL, both work just fine), only this game is refusing to boot.
I have tried setting my game load to all of the different video mode options In USB Loader GX and none of them have resolved the issue.

Try going to page 9 of the thread : someone had the same issue as you, and could solve it by following a step-by-step procedure to patch their iso.
Maybe try going the same, because it seems the iso doesn't work on dolphin either, which is weird (the save file issue happens typically on real hardware, patched iso or not).
Also, some people seem to have found a solution by using wiiflow once, all of these troubles being apparently related with the fact that some Wiis have issues creating the ticket for the game.
Let me know how it worked!
